declare namespace jest {
|
|
function addMatchers(matchers: jasmine.CustomMatcherFactories):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Disables automatic mocking in the module loader. */
|
|
function autoMockOff(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Enables automatic mocking in the module loader. */
|
|
function autoMockOn(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Clears the mock.calls and mock.instances properties of all mocks. Equivalent to calling .mockClear() on every mocked function. */
|
|
function clearAllMocks(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Removes any pending timers from the timer system. If any timers have been scheduled, they will be cleared and will never have the opportunity to execute in the future. */
|
|
function clearAllTimers(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Indicates that the module system should never return a mocked version of the specified module, including all of the specificied module's dependencies. */
|
|
function deepUnmock(moduleName: string):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Disables automatic mocking in the module loader. */
|
|
function disableAutomock(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Mocks a module with an auto-mocked version when it is being required. */
|
|
function doMock(moduleName: string):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Indicates that the module system should never return a mocked version of the specified module from require() (e.g. that it should always return the real module). */
|
|
function dontMock(moduleName: string):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Enables automatic mocking in the module loader. */
|
|
function enableAutomock(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Creates a mock function. Optionally takes a mock implementation. */
|
|
function fn<T>(implementation?: Function): Mock<T>;
|
|
/** Use the automatic mocking system to generate a mocked version of the given module. */
|
|
function genMockFromModule<T>(moduleName: string): T;
|
|
/** Returns whether the given function is a mock function. */
|
|
function isMockFunction(fn: any): fn is Mock<any>;
|
|
/** Mocks a module with an auto-mocked version when it is being required. */
|
|
function mock(moduleName: string, factory?: any, options?: MockOptions):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Resets the module registry - the cache of all required modules. This is useful to isolate modules where local state might conflict between tests. */
|
|
function resetModuleRegistry(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Resets the module registry - the cache of all required modules. This is useful to isolate modules where local state might conflict between tests. */
|
|
function resetModules(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Exhausts tasks queued by setImmediate(). */
|
|
function runAllImmediates(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Exhausts the micro-task queue (usually interfaced in node via process.nextTick). */
|
|
function runAllTicks(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Exhausts the macro-task queue (i.e., all tasks queued by setTimeout() and setInterval()). */
|
|
function runAllTimers(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Executes only the macro-tasks that are currently pending (i.e., only the tasks that have been queued by setTimeout() or setInterval() up to this point).
|
|
* If any of the currently pending macro-tasks schedule new macro-tasks, those new tasks will not be executed by this call. */
|
|
function runOnlyPendingTimers(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Executes only the macro task queue (i.e. all tasks queued by setTimeout() or setInterval() and setImmediate()). */
|
|
function runTimersToTime(msToRun: number):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Explicitly supplies the mock object that the module system should return for the specified module. */
|
|
function setMock<T>(moduleName: string, moduleExports: T):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Indicates that the module system should never return a mocked version of the specified module from require() (e.g. that it should always return the real module). */
|
|
function unmock(moduleName: string):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Instructs Jest to use fake versions of the standard timer functions. */
|
|
function useFakeTimers(): typeof jest;
|
|
/** Instructs Jest to use the real versions of the standard timer functions. */
|
|
function useRealTimers(): typeof jest;

interface SpyAnd {
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with and.callThrough, the spy will still track all calls to it but in addition it will delegate to the actual implementation. */
|
|
callThrough(): Spy;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with and.returnValue, all calls to the function will return a specific value. */
|
|
returnValue(val: any): Spy;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with and.returnValues, all calls to the function will return specific values in order until it reaches the end of the return values list. */
|
|
returnValues(...values: any[]): Spy;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with and.callFake, all calls to the spy will delegate to the supplied function. */
|
|
callFake(fn: Function): Spy;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with and.throwError, all calls to the spy will throw the specified value. */
|
|
throwError(msg: string): Spy;
|
|
/** When a calling strategy is used for a spy, the original stubbing behavior can be returned at any time with and.stub. */
|
|
stub(): Spy;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
interface Calls {
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.any(), will return false if the spy has not been called at all, and then true once at least one call happens. */
|
|
any(): boolean;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.count(), will return the number of times the spy was called */
|
|
count(): number;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.argsFor(), will return the arguments passed to call number index */
|
|
argsFor(index: number): any[];
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.allArgs(), will return the arguments to all calls */
|
|
allArgs(): any[];
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.all(), will return the context (the this) and arguments passed all calls */
|
|
all(): CallInfo[];
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.mostRecent(), will return the context (the this) and arguments for the most recent call */
|
|
mostRecent(): CallInfo;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.first(), will return the context (the this) and arguments for the first call */
|
|
first(): CallInfo;
|
|
/** By chaining the spy with calls.reset(), will clears all tracking for a spy */
|
|
reset(): void;
|
|
}
